Dear Sriman Sudarshan :

I can not agree with you more .

You are absolutely right in arriving at the conclusion
that the two kinds of kaimkaryam at dhivya dEsams
and abhimAna sthalams are equal in importance .

AabharaNa SamarpaNam , Vasthra samarpaNam , 
TadhiyArAdhanam during the uthsavam days and
most importantly  ThiruvArAdhanam support is one kind .

The other kind is cleaning of the streets around the temple 
(Veethi sOdhanam) and providing other services for SevArthees 
to make their visits to the temples  comfortable and worry free .

Great AchAryAs like ThirukkaNNa Mangai ANDAN have taken
the broom and cleansed the prAkArams and considered that
Kaimkaryam as a blessed one . Keeping the premises of
the temple clean and hyginic especailly in these days 
is the highest of kaimkaryams .

> Why should you assume that the two kinds of 'kainkaryam' are 
> mutually exclusive? One can strive to accomplish both, can't one? 
> Both are equally worthy causes, aren't they?
> 
> Also, what makes you so sure the Lord will appreciate an offering  
> of "aabharaNams" and "vastrams" from devotees far more than He will 
> accept a toilet-facility to be built at his Abode on earth? In my 
> dictionary, an offering of "aabharaNam" to the Almighty 
> is "bhagavath-kainkaryam". An offering to the Lord that takes the 
> form of a "kainkaryam" to build a toilet-facility for the temple at 
> Perumbudur is "bhaagavatha-kainkaryam". Both are equally pleasing to 
> the Almighty. At least that's what the SriVaishnva faith says, 
> doesn't it?
> 
> One is no inferior or superior to the other. And in today's 
> conditions prevailing at Sri Perumbudur temple and as well as at 
> many other temples in T.Nadu, I daresay a public lavatory for 
> pilgrims is as necessary and essential as a "mUtthAngi" 
> or "vairAngi" for the Deity.
